Raichu gains STAB for Surf, (Volt) Tackle, and a nice boost in attack. Slam and Bubble both add some very nice options to her movepool and will help her against the traditional special walls. She functions pretty much the same as always, though she now fears Grasses and loses resistance to Electric. Still, this pokemon is no modest mouse.
Raichu is built as an anti-Water Pokemon, attacking for major damage and taking back neutral at worst except for Blastoise. Raichu also has Physical options to cover Grass and Dragon, and can Paralyzes as always. |

Raichu gets a boost from his new-found Water typing. Now having STAB Water moves, he only fears Grasses and Dragons, as he can hit everything else for at least neutral with his STAB moves. Paralyzing with Thunder Wave is still an important job that Raichu does, and he also has Fighting and Normal options for physical attacking, which hurts coming from 298 Attack. Watch out when up against physicals, as they'll dent Raichu with ease.
